Transaction 2024310e8632bebefdc047a3d0089fe76bb999029572cee054b6697595bb9b31
1 Input
1 Output
-
2024310e8632bebefdc047a3d0089fe76bb999029572cee054b6697595bb9b31:0
- value
- 317808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 570ea968aa95eb7eaac7a385ce3e15809ce2bdea OP_EQUAL
- address
- 39dLGx2JpFcYPgmCwfRV2ZpzoLjw4nrquy